Sexual Maturity & Breeding Readiness

Understanding the distinction between sexual maturity and breeding readiness is essential before undertaking any Algerian Hedgehog breeding program. Males can produce viable sperm as early as six to eight weeks of age, and females can conceive by approximately three to four months. However, physiological capability does not equal breeding readiness. Responsible breeders wait until both the male and female have reached full physical maturity and optimal body condition before attempting a pairing.

Females should not be bred before six months of age at the earliest, and many experienced breeders prefer to wait until the female is at least eight months old and has reached a stable adult weight of 280 grams or more. Breeding a female that is too young or too small carries elevated risks of dystocia — difficult or obstructed labor — maternal exhaustion, and litter rejection. The female's pelvic structure and musculature are not fully developed until she is at least six months old, and earlier pregnancies place undue stress on her still-maturing body.

Males intended for breeding should be at least five to six months old, in robust health, and at a normal body weight. Obese males may have reduced fertility and can be physically clumsy during mating, potentially injuring the female. Both the male and female should undergo a pre-breeding veterinary examination that includes a thorough physical assessment, fecal parasite screening, and skin evaluation for mites or fungal infection. Breeding animals with active parasite burdens or skin conditions risks transmitting those issues to the mate and subsequently to the offspring.

Breeders should also evaluate each animal's temperament and lineage before pairing. Hedgehogs with a history of Wobbly Hedgehog Syndrome in their pedigree should not be bred, as the condition has a suspected hereditary component. Similarly, animals with known congenital defects, chronic health issues, or extremely defensive temperaments that make handling dangerous are not suitable breeding candidates. The goal of a responsible breeding program is to produce healthy, well-tempered offspring — not simply to produce offspring.

Mate Introduction & Mating Behavior

Introducing two Algerian Hedgehogs for breeding requires careful management, as these solitary animals can react aggressively to the sudden presence of a conspecific in their space. The introduction should take place on neutral ground — an enclosure or area that neither animal has previously occupied — to reduce territorial aggression. Attempting to place the male directly into the female's established enclosure, or vice versa, significantly increases the risk of fighting.

The neutral introduction area should be spacious enough for both hedgehogs to move freely, with no dead ends or corners where one animal can trap the other. Place both hedgehogs in the area simultaneously and observe from a close but non-intrusive distance. Initial reactions typically include mutual sniffing, circling, and some degree of huffing and defensive posturing. This is normal exploratory behavior. If either animal launches a sustained aggressive attack — biting, headbutting, or persistent chasing with clear intent to harm — separate them immediately and attempt the introduction again after several days.

Courtship in Algerian Hedgehogs involves the male circling the female persistently, often for extended periods, while producing a rhythmic huffing or purring vocalization. The female may initially respond by huffing, balling, or running away. Patience is required, as courtship can take anywhere from a few minutes to several hours before the female becomes receptive. When the female is ready to mate, she will flatten her spines against her body and assume a lordosis posture, lowering her head and raising her hindquarters to allow the male to mount.

Mating itself is brief, lasting only a few minutes, but the male will typically attempt to mate multiple times over the course of the introduction session. Most breeders leave the pair together for four to seven days to maximize the likelihood of successful conception, though the pair should be monitored daily for signs of aggression or injury. If the female becomes hostile toward the male — actively attacking rather than simply rebuffing his advances — the animals should be separated, as prolonged cohabitation is stressful for a solitary species and can lead to serious wounds.

Gestation & Prenatal Care

The gestation period of the Algerian Hedgehog averages 35 to 40 days, with some variation among individuals. Confirming pregnancy in hedgehogs is difficult during the early weeks, as there is no reliable at-home test and the behavioral signs are subtle. Some females show a modest increase in appetite and water consumption during the second half of gestation, while others exhibit no discernible behavioral changes until a few days before delivery.

Weight gain becomes the most reliable indicator of pregnancy from approximately the midpoint of gestation onward. A pregnant female will typically gain 30 to 80 grams over the course of the pregnancy, depending on litter size. Continue weekly weigh-ins using a digital gram scale, but handle the female as gently as possible during the latter half of gestation. Excessive handling, loud noises, and environmental disturbances can elevate stress hormones, which may increase the risk of reabsorption — a process in which the developing embryos are reabsorbed by the body rather than carried to term.

Nutrition during gestation should be enhanced to support both the female and her developing young. Increase protein availability by offering additional insects — mealworms, waxworms, and crickets — alongside the standard high-quality kibble. Some breeders supplement with small amounts of scrambled egg or cooked, unseasoned chicken for extra protein. Ensure fresh water is always available, as fluid requirements increase during pregnancy. A calcium supplement, such as a light dusting of calcium carbonate on insects, supports skeletal development in the offspring without oversupplementing.

As the estimated due date approaches, prepare the female's enclosure for delivery. Provide abundant nesting material — torn strips of plain paper towel, unscented tissue, or fleece scraps — and ensure the hiding spot is large enough for the female and a litter. Remove the running wheel from the enclosure approximately one week before the expected delivery date, as heavily pregnant females can injure themselves on wheels and the wheel poses a hazard to newborn hoglets that may wander. Minimize all disturbances in the area surrounding the enclosure, and restrict access to essential caregivers only.

Delivery & Immediate Postpartum

Delivery in Algerian Hedgehogs typically occurs at night, consistent with the species' nocturnal nature, and the process is generally quick — most litters are delivered within one to three hours. Litter size ranges from one to ten hoglets, with three to six being the most common count. The female delivers the hoglets one at a time, each enclosed in an amniotic sac that she tears open with her teeth. She then severs the umbilical cord and consumes the placenta, which provides a concentrated source of nutrients and hormones that support lactation onset.

Do not intervene during delivery unless there is a clear, life-threatening emergency. The female needs quiet, darkness, and the absolute absence of perceived threats. Even well-intentioned attempts to check on progress — shining a flashlight, lifting the hiding spot, or reaching into the enclosure — can trigger panic and lead to litter cannibalization. If you suspect delivery has stalled (more than two hours between hoglets with visible straining or distress), contact your exotics veterinarian by phone for guidance before taking any physical action.

Immediately after delivery, the female will gather the hoglets beneath her and begin nursing. The hoglets should latch on and nurse within the first one to two hours. Resist the temptation to count, inspect, or weigh the hoglets for at least 48 hours, and longer if the dam shows any signs of anxiety. First-time mothers are at the highest risk for litter rejection and cannibalization, and disturbance during the first 48 hours is the single most common trigger.

The dam's food and water should be placed as close to the nest as possible during the immediate postpartum period so she does not need to travel far and leave the hoglets exposed. Increase the quantity and protein content of her food, as the caloric demands of lactation are substantial. A postpartum dam may eat two to three times her normal food intake. Observe from a distance — or via a pre-positioned camera — to confirm that the female is eating, drinking, and spending the majority of her time with the hoglets.

Postpartum Complications

While most Algerian Hedgehog deliveries proceed without incident, breeders must be prepared to recognize and respond to postpartum complications that can threaten the health or life of the dam, the hoglets, or both. Having an emergency plan and a veterinarian's after-hours contact information readily available before the expected delivery date is not overcautious — it is responsible.

Retained placenta is a potential complication that occurs when one or more placentas are not expelled after delivery. Signs include persistent straining after the last hoglet has been delivered, a foul-smelling vaginal discharge, lethargy, and loss of appetite. A retained placenta can lead to uterine infection (metritis) and sepsis if untreated. If the dam shows signs of retained placenta within 24 hours of delivery, contact your veterinarian immediately.

Mastitis — infection of one or more mammary glands — can develop during the first two weeks of lactation. An affected gland appears swollen, reddened, warm to the touch, and painful. The dam may resist nursing due to the pain, which in turn puts the hoglets at risk of malnutrition. Mastitis requires prompt veterinary treatment with appropriate antibiotics. While the dam is being treated, supplemental feeding of the hoglets with a suitable milk replacer may be necessary.

Litter rejection and cannibalization, while distressing, are not uncommon in hedgehog breeding. First-time mothers, mothers disturbed during or shortly after delivery, and mothers under environmental stress are at the highest risk. Cannibalization may also occur when a hoglet is sick, deformed, or otherwise nonviable, as the dam instinctively removes individuals unlikely to survive. If selective cannibalization occurs — the dam rejects one or two hoglets while continuing to nurse the rest — the surviving hoglets should be left undisturbed. If the dam rejects the entire litter, immediate hand-rearing intervention is the only option for the hoglets' survival.

Postpartum depression of the dam's overall condition — weight loss, lethargy, unkempt appearance, and disinterest in food — can signal exhaustion, infection, or nutritional depletion. Large litters and inadequate prenatal nutrition are predisposing factors. Supportive care including high-calorie food, fluid supplementation, and veterinary assessment can often stabilize a declining dam, but the hoglets may need supplemental feeding to reduce the metabolic burden on the mother.

Breeding Frequency & Recovery

Responsible breeding practices include strict limitations on how frequently a female Algerian Hedgehog is bred. Pregnancy, lactation, and postpartum recovery are physically demanding processes that deplete the female's nutritional reserves, stress her organ systems, and leave her more susceptible to illness. Back-to-back breeding without adequate recovery time can shorten a female's lifespan, increase the incidence of complications in subsequent litters, and reduce the health and viability of her offspring.

A female should be allowed a minimum of three to four months of rest between weaning one litter and conceiving the next. During this recovery period, her weight should return to pre-pregnancy levels, her body condition should be robust, and she should show normal activity patterns and appetite. Breeding a female that has not fully recovered is irresponsible and significantly increases the risk of dystocia, small litter size, weak hoglets, and maternal exhaustion.

Most experienced breeders limit a female Algerian Hedgehog to no more than two to three litters per year, and some prefer a maximum of two. After three years of age, the risks associated with pregnancy increase, and many breeders retire females from their breeding programs at this point. Males can continue breeding for a longer period, as the physical toll on the male is minimal compared to the female, but even stud males should be in excellent health and maintained on a high-quality diet.

A responsible breeding program also plans for the placement of every hoglet before a pairing is made. Algerian Hedgehogs are solitary animals that each require their own enclosure, equipment, and ongoing care. Producing hoglets without confirmed homes leads to overcrowding, compromised care, and the risk that surplus animals will be surrendered to rescues or released — outcomes that are harmful to both the individual animals and the broader captive population.

Ethics & Legal Considerations

Breeding Algerian Hedgehogs carries ethical and legal responsibilities that extend well beyond the mechanics of mating and delivery. The decision to breed should be driven by a commitment to improving the captive population through careful genetic management, health screening, and temperament selection — not by curiosity, profit, or the desire to produce a litter for personal entertainment.

Legal status varies significantly by jurisdiction. Algerian Hedgehogs are legal to keep and breed in many regions, but some states, provinces, and countries classify all hedgehog species as restricted or prohibited wildlife. In the United States, hedgehog ownership is illegal in California, Georgia, Hawaii, and Pennsylvania, and is restricted in several other states. Municipal regulations may impose additional requirements such as permits, enclosure inspections, or breeder licensing. Verify the laws in your specific jurisdiction before acquiring breeding stock, and ensure you are in full compliance with all applicable wildlife, animal welfare, and zoning regulations.

Genetic diversity within captive Algerian Hedgehog populations is a genuine concern. The majority of captive hedgehogs in the pet trade descend from a relatively narrow genetic founder population, and indiscriminate breeding without attention to pedigree can accelerate inbreeding depression — a reduction in health, vigor, and fertility caused by the accumulation of harmful recessive alleles. Responsible breeders maintain detailed pedigree records spanning multiple generations and avoid pairing related individuals. Some breeders participate in cooperative networks that facilitate the exchange of unrelated breeding stock to broaden genetic diversity.

Hedgehog welfare organizations and breed registries, where they exist, can be valuable resources for breeders seeking guidance on best practices, genetic management, and placement standards. Aligning your breeding program with established ethical guidelines — even if no regulatory body requires it — demonstrates a commitment to animal welfare that benefits the animals, the keeper community, and the long-term sustainability of captive hedgehog populations.
